A little history that amuses me.
The Spurs signed Horry to a one year deal for 4.5M in 2003. He was pretty bad for the Spurs in 2003-04 and he signed a second one year deal for only 1.1M for the next season. So when Horry went nuts in the 2005 playoffs he was basically on a minimum contract.
That got him three more years for a total of about 10M, and he earned every penny with one well-placed and well-timed hip check.
